Pakistan Says It's Holding Indian Pilot After Jet Shot Down In Cross-Border Airstrike

NPR: In a dramatic escalation of violence over their shared Himalayan border, India and Pakistan both claimed to shoot down one another's fighter jets Wednesday, and video emerged of a bloodied, blindfolded Indian pilot in Pakistani custody.

Both countries accused the other of invading rival airspace. India confirmed the loss of one of its MiG-21 fighter jets in an "engagement" with Pakistani forces, and acknowledged its pilot was missing.
